## Nightly Backfill Scheduler (Marloweth)

The Marloweth scheduler kicks off data backfills at 02:10 local cluster time. Before touching anything, confirm the previous night's run finished by checking the completion marker in the ops dashboard. Never restart a run mid-window; partial backfills corrupt the dedup ledger and require a manual sweep. If you change retry limits, note it in the shift log. The scheduler reads the following configuration at startup.

deployment values, bagag-bawig:
DRUVAN_PIN=0740
DRUVAN_TENANT=wendor
DRUVAN_METRICS_HOST=metrics.druvan.tolvaqnet.example
DRUVAN_SEAL=seal_75cd0b2d
DRUVAN_STANDBY_TEAM=tamael

## Runbook: ChipGate Reader — Riverbend Marathon

If the ChipGate reader at the finish arch stops posting splits, first check the antenna mat cable — it gets kicked loose every single race, no joke. Power-cycle the reader unit, wait for the green sync light, then confirm events are flowing into the TimingHub dashboard. If the dashboard shows the reader as unauthorized, the upload agent probably lost its config after the power cycle. Re-register it with the TimingHub ingest API using the key below.

gateway credential: kto7_GoY89Me

Subject: DR drill — Gatewarden rate limiting review

Hi Priya-of-review-duty (joking — hello Oleth),

Before Thursday's disaster-recovery drill, please review the token-bucket changes in Gatewarden's internal gateway. The drill will replay burst traffic at 3x normal, and the per-tenant limiter must shed load without starving the Fennick billing service. Pay special attention to the refill-rate override path. To unlock the drill's standby config store, use the passphrase below.

unlock words, fadug-tageg: zorix-wenwyn-quenmir

// REINDEX_BATCH_CAP limits docs per shard pass in the Tallowfield
// nightly search reindex. Raising it starves the ingest queue;
// lowering it overruns the maintenance window. 5000 is the tested
// sweet spot. Change only with a soak run. Verified against the
// build noted below.

session token of bawif-hahog = htk6_ac5981